About MSC GAYANE
MSC GAYANE is recorded as a Container Ship. The vessel currently sails under the flag of Liberia (LR). Its recorded year of build is 2018. The vessel carries IMO number 9770763, which serves as its persistent maritime identifier.
Recorded particulars for MSC GAYANE include a length of 314.33 m, a beam of 48.41 m, gross tonnage of 102492, deadweight of 120500 t, container capacity of 10776 TEU. The specific vessel type is Container Ship, while the broader classification is Cargo – Hazard A (Major). These figures are stored vessel particulars and should not be interpreted as live measurements.
Operational identifiers currently recorded for MSC GAYANE include MMSI 636018276 and call sign D5OZ5. MMSI and call sign can change during a vessel’s service life, whereas a valid IMO number normally remains the primary persistent identifier.

Casualties & incidents
The three most recent recorded casualty or incident events are shown below.
Container ship had propulsion loss as she was entering Golden Gate, San Francisco, en route from Los Angeles to Oakland. Several tugs responded and helped vessel pass Golden Gate and anchor at San Francisco anchorage.
